RabbitMQ Message Queue Using .NET Core 6 Web API

Introduction Here, we’ll understand how to setting up a RabbitMQ message queue using .NET Core 6 Web API. In this example, we’ll create a simple producer and consumer for sending and receiving messages through RabbitMQ. Step 1: Install RabbitMQ.Client NuGet Package In your .NET Core 6 Web API project, open …

Implementation And Containerization Of Microservices Using .NET Core 6 And Docker

Introduction Here, I’ll give you an example of implementing and containerizing microservices using .NET Core 6 and Docker. In this example, we’ll create two simple microservices, a “ProductService” and an “OrderService,” and then containerize them using Docker. Step 1: Create Microservices Create two separate .NET Core 6 Web API projects …

Implementation Of Global Exception Handling Using .NET Core 6 Web API

Introduction Implementing global exception handling in a .NET Core 6 Web API involves creating a custom middleware to catch and handle exceptions that occur during the request pipeline. This allows you to centralize error handling and provide consistent responses to clients. Here’s an example of how you can implement global …

SignalR Introduction And Implementation Using The .NET Core 6 Web API And Angular 14

Introduction SignalR is a real-time communication library that allows you to add real-time functionality to your applications, enabling bi-directional communication between clients and servers. In this example, we’ll introduce SignalR and demonstrate its implementation using a .NET Core 6 Web API backend and an Angular 14 frontend. Step 1: Create …